Punaj - Matar, Kheda
Punaj is a village situated in the Matar taluka of Kheda district, Gujarat. It is located approximately 9 km from the tehsil headquarters in Matar and around 12 km from the district headquarters in Nadiad. Punaj village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Punaj is 517546. The village covers a total geographical area of 499.95 hectares and falls under the 387520 pincode. Nadiad is the nearest town, located about 12 km away.
Punaj village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Matar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kheda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Punaj
According to the 2011 Census, Punaj village had a total population of 929 people, including 487 males and 442 females, living in 192 households. The sex ratio was 908 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 76.94%, with male literacy at 86.25% and female literacy at 66.84%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 14,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 9.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 929 | 487 | 442 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 105 | 58 | 47 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 14 | 7 | 7 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 9 | 4 | 5 |
| Literate Population | 634 | 370 | 264 |
| Illiterate Population | 295 | 117 | 178 |

Transport and Connectivity of Punaj
Public transport in the Punaj is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Nadiad to Punaj is about 12 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Punaj
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Punaj village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Punaj
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Punaj village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
